Daniel Rodríguez Troitiño e60785e1ef [test] Mark some tests as requiring Swift Syntax (#70493)
Some of the tests now depend on features provided by Swift Syntax, and
will fail to pass if building without Swift Syntax support.

This commits marks all the tests I know fail to pass when Swift Syntax
is disabled.

- #70281 modified `ASTGen/verify-parse.swift`
- #70287 created `refactoring/SyntacticRename/operator.swift` and `SourceKit/RelatedIdents/operator.swift`
- #70389 modified `SourceKit/Refactoring/basic.swift` and indirectly
  modified all `refactoring/ExtractFunction/*` tests.

func longLongLongJourney() async -> Int { 0 }
func longLongLongAwryJourney() async throws -> Int { 0 }
func consumesAsync(_ fn: () async throws -> Void) rethrows {}
func testThrowingClosure() async throws -> Int {
let x = await longLongLongJourney()
let y = try await longLongLongAwryJourney() + 1
try consumesAsync { try await longLongLongAwryJourney() }
return x + y
}
// RUN: %empty-directory(%t.result)
// RUN: %refactor -extract-function -source-filename %s -pos=6:11 -end-pos=6:38 >> %t.result/async1.swift
// RUN: diff -u %S/Outputs/await/async1.swift.expected %t.result/async1.swift
// RUN: %refactor -extract-function -source-filename %s -pos=7:11 -end-pos=7:50 >> %t.result/async2.swift
// RUN: diff -u %S/Outputs/await/async2.swift.expected %t.result/async2.swift
// RUN: %refactor -extract-function -source-filename %s -pos=8:1 -end-pos=8:60 >> %t.result/consumes_async.swift
// RUN: diff -u %S/Outputs/await/consumes_async.swift.expected %t.result/consumes_async.swift
// REQUIRES: swift_swift_parser
